Jesielyn is a modern, melodic name thought to combine Hebrew roots 'Jesi' (from Jesse, meaning 'gift') and the suffix '-lyn' (common in English names), implying 'God's gracious gift' or 'devoted to God.' While not historically ancient, it emerges from contemporary naming trends blending spirituality with lyrical sounds.

Cultural Significance of Jesielyn

Jesielyn, while a modern creation, reflects a growing trend in blending traditional Hebrew roots with English suffixes to create fresh, meaningful names. It embodies devotion and gift-giving, resonating with spiritual families valuing faith and individuality in naming. Its melodic structure appeals across cultures, especially in English-speaking and Filipino communities where such hybrid names flourish.

Jesielyn Name Popularity in 2025

Jesielyn has gained popularity in recent years, particularly in the Philippines and among English-speaking parents seeking unique yet meaningful names. It fits contemporary trends favoring lyrical, multi-syllabic names ending in -lyn. Though not widely charted, Jesielyn is embraced for its distinctive sound and spiritual undertones, often chosen by parents wanting a name that is both modern and rooted in faith.
